Pritzker announces $25M to strengthen pharmacy access across Illinois
- Updated
Governor JB Pritzker, the Illinois Department of Commerce and Economic Opportunity, and the Illinois Retail Merchants Association announced $24.7 million in funding for 434 entities through the Illinois Pharmacy Support Program.
